## Deployment

GratiPost sends donation receipts for the Lumenreach fundraising platform. Deploys run via the Kestrel pipeline; support does not trigger them, but may need to verify settings after a release. The mail queue drains automatically within ten minutes. If receipts stall, confirm the service is running with these values.

config for bawep-faduf:
OLIATH_HOST=oliath.qorvellabs.internal
OLIATH_PORT=9000

# Settings for GridWeaver, the crossword generator used by the Puzzlecraft team.
# The solver caches candidate word lists aggressively, so the lexicon store must
# be reachable before the first grid is seeded; otherwise fill quality degrades
# silently. Reviewers: note that pool size is capped at 12 because the lexicon
# replica at the Bramley site throttles beyond that. All timeouts are in
# milliseconds and were tuned against the nightly benchmark. The lexicon
# database is reached via the connection string below.

replica DSN, kajep-yahag: mssql://praok_svc:iF@db-8d68.plorvaio.local:5432/eliion

## Hot-reload procedure — Kestrelbox

Kestrelbox watches its config directory and reloads within five seconds of a write, without restarting workers. Support should verify the reload log line before declaring a change applied; partial writes are rejected atomically. The reloadable configuration values currently in effect are the following.

deployment values, bahap-bahip:
[eliath]
team = gorius
access_code = ac_9ce55b
owner = holion.eliius
host = eliath.nelvrohq.internal
port = 8443
peer = kaswyn.merlaqlabs.test
salt = 01afd960
pin = 5193

**Q: Which tool do we use for GPU memory profiling before a release cut?**

Use Vramlens 3.x, bundled with the Ostrava build image. Run the profiling suite against the release candidate on the benchmark rig and attach the report to the release ticket; builds exceeding the 11.5 GB ceiling are blocked automatically. Historical baselines live in the perf dashboard under "Memory Trends." If the tooling itself fails or reports look corrupted, contact the profiling team directly.

escalation mailbox, yafog-kafof: eliok@xolmarcloud.local